Abstract:
Objective To investigate the current status of the indoor air pollution in urban area in Beijing and find the influence factors for the concentrations of formaldehyde and nitrogen oxides (NOx) indoors. Methods 463 persons were chosen randomly from Xicheng district of Beijing to complete the questionnaires about their indoor environment condition. The levels of formaldehyde and NOx were monitored in the bedrooms and the kitchens of 91 households. And we used the multi-regression model to find out some influence factors that related to formaldehyde and NOx concentration. Results The average daily concentration of formaldehyde in the bedrooms was about 0.049 mg/m3 and the rate of excess standard was 13%.
